propellor spin
This commit is contained in:
parent
41a23743e7
commit
3d617fd98b
|
@ -76,8 +76,8 @@ hostMap :: [Host] -> M.Map HostName Host
|
||||||
hostMap l = M.fromList $ zip (map hostName l) l
|
hostMap l = M.fromList $ zip (map hostName l) l
|
||||||
|
|
||||||
aliasMap :: [Host] -> M.Map HostName Host
|
aliasMap :: [Host] -> M.Map HostName Host
|
||||||
aliasMap l = M.fromList $ concat $ map (flip zip l) $
|
aliasMap = M.fromList . concat .
|
||||||
map (S.toList . _aliases . hostInfo) l
|
map (\h -> map (\aka -> (aka, h)) $ S.toList $ _aliases $ hostInfo h)
|
||||||
|
|
||||||
findHost :: [Host] -> HostName -> Maybe Host
|
findHost :: [Host] -> HostName -> Maybe Host
|
||||||
findHost l hn = maybe (findAlias l hn) Just (M.lookup hn (hostMap l))
|
findHost l hn = maybe (findAlias l hn) Just (M.lookup hn (hostMap l))
|
||||||
|
|
Loading…
Reference in New Issue